Transaction 63d32876bbfbaa20673490fdae5ef4f2e6df6c095674a3cfdce7198923f73cf3

1 Input
2 Outputs
  • 63d32876bbfbaa20673490fdae5ef4f2e6df6c095674a3cfdce7198923f73cf3:0
  • value  50000
    address  17AhLDp9wewYW2vE25xbyvMLxjqd8iirjY
  • 63d32876bbfbaa20673490fdae5ef4f2e6df6c095674a3cfdce7198923f73cf3:1
  • value  4647088
    address  3LRmSWgQEgJ7bGnWcQhHWiJKbt3W6B5Xvs